About Kingstate Electronics Corp.
Kingstate Electronics Corp. manufactures and sells acoustic products in Taiwan and internationally. The company offers various products, including piezo buzzers, magnetic buzzers, micro speakers, dynamic receivers, Bluetooth speakers, and electret condenser microphones; and audio products, such as earphones, wired and wireless headphones, Bluetooth headphones, sports headphones, gaming headphones, TWS products, wireless speakers, and PSAP products; speaker module/mic module products; and personal sound amplifiers, etc. It also provides OEM/ODM/JDM services for IP audio systems, comprising IP Horn Speaker, IP indoor speaker, and IP audio gateway device. The company's products are used in telecommunications, consumer electronics, AI and IoT devices, information technology, home appliances, automotive, security, medical and industrial equipment sectors. Kingstate Electronics Corp. was founded in 1977 and is headquartered in New Taipei City, Taiwan.
